                <description><![CDATA[ ...to mention one thing I did in Russia. I got myself contact lenses for the first time in my life. Ridiculously cheap as well. Still not quite used to them, but I'm getting there. As a well known Swedish proverb says: "If you want to look nice, you will have to suffer".<br /><br />Some local customs I forgot to mention as well. In general they seem to be quite superstitious in Murmansk, and probably in Russia in general. You are not allowed to whistle indoors. It could have an unfortunate effect on the family's economics. In this context I should mention that I am a notorious whistler... I just had to clam it as long as Taya's mother was home.<br />   One other superstition is this that you should not give anything over a threshold. It is said to cause quarrelling in the house you visit. Taya actually was told by a person we were visiting to get in and give her the package inside and would not take it before she did so.<br />   A friend of Tayas father visited one evening (a really nice guy with black moustaches), and since his name was the same as her fathers (Anatolij) he invited me to stand between them and make a wish. But I wont tell you what I wished or if it came true. <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/w/wink.gif" width="15" height="15" alt=";)" title=";) (Wink)" /><br /><br /> ]]></description>

                <description><![CDATA[ First of all I just want to point anyone interested in Myst to look <a href="http://mystmovie.com/">here</a>.<br /><br />I guess that "More later today..." was a bit too ambitious of me. <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/r/razz.gif" width="15" height="15" alt="=P" title="=P (Razz)" /><br />But here is <i>at last</i>his is the second and last part of my review of my trip to the amazing magical land of Oz... I mean Russia... that's not really magical... at least not like Oz... thank goodness...<br /><br />I spent almost all the time in Russia illegally. No seriously, I was supposed to register myself when I came there and that's also what I did. One hour before closing time on the last day I could do it, two days after my arrival. Lets just say I was a bit distracted and forgot it. <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/w/winkrazz.gif" width="15" height="15" alt=";P" title="Wink/Razz" /> The thing is that two or three days before I left they called and said that we had forgotten to ad the migration paper to the registration. Without that the registration could not be completed. Not sure if I could have left the country without that either. We got them their paper in time though, but that means that I spent most of the time ther without permission. Just don't tell any KGB spy... <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/n/ninja.gif" width="19" height="19" alt=":ninja:" title="Ninja" /><br /><br />So for the issue with men in suits. So far as I can recall I saw... a lot of men in suits in Murmansk. Not to mention on my way there and back. Both times I sat RIGHT NEXT TO a man in a suit. Even Tayas father turned out to be one of them. <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/e/eek.gif" width="15" height="15" alt=":O" title=":O (Eek)" /> Not one of them were really mysterious, sexy or devious though. So you can rest at peace. <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/w/wink.gif" width="15" height="15" alt=";)" title=";) (Wink)" /><br /><br />Now for the weather which was strangely warm for February, and especially at that longitude. Her father said that all the ice in the arctic sea was melting as well. The temperature never went below -15Â°C (some plus-degrees some days even) but the wind anf humidity made it feel like 25Â°C. Nothing I'm not used to, and Taya who's used to temperatures sometimes 20Â° and more below that thought it was ridiculously warm. I could not complain on the amount of snow there really, only the colour of it. The thousands of cars had given most of it a sickly shade of grey. Yuck...<br /><br />The architecture was... not that impressive all the time. Where Taya lived there was a huge area with grey houses that all looked the same. And the rest could be said for the rest of the houses there. Nothing really caught my eye, but I'm sure I would have seen better things if I could have had a better view from a higher place. Would have been nice to have visited one of the orthodox Basilicas. Have always loved their onion-shaped towers. <br /><br />There were many different types of smells there. There was nice smells there. Like the vanilla smell of my honey, or borsch, or the "zasliks" we had at the restaurant. But there were many unpleasant ones as well. Like the smell of constantly smoking people, or the smell of dog-urine, or of the car exhausts (especially Ladas for some reason...). <br /><br />Interesting local customs then... They had milk in bags (as I've heard they also do in Canada?)... and it's not possible to find good hot chocolate there. We tried to order that in the sushi restaurant and got something that closely resembled melted chocolate pudding, and on later comparison actually turned out to be exactly that.<br /><br />Murmansk was also full of tiny little old ladies with huge fur coats and hats and a no nonsense attitude. You know, the type you thought only existed in movies. Don't even try to mess with them, they've got super powers and some of them carried sticks... <br /><br /><br />You got any more questions? Please ask and I will answer if possible.<br /><br /> ]]></description>

                <description><![CDATA[ ...part one.<br /><br />Second try.<br />My first journal got deleted by mistake by clumsy me, and since I don't want to go through all that again this wont be quite as detailed as that version. This on I will largely base it on the questions raised by ~<a class="u" href="http://jpjohansson.deviantart.com/">JPJohansson</a> in my last journal. I'll also break it up into two, or perhaps (but probably not) three parts. Easier for me, and less for you poor guys to read. <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/w/wink.gif" width="15" height="15" alt=";)" title=";) (Wink)" /><br /><br />The trip itself went absolutely fine despite all my worries. I left Sweden 13:10  and landed three and a half hour later (with two hours added due to time zone shifting). For anyone interested I flew on the same plane as former Swedish minister of foreign affairs Leif Pagrotsky. No idea what he was going to do in St. Petersburg or why he was flying economy class like me though. <br />   Well there I got a bit lost first at the airport. but the lady in the information booth kindly enough (Though she was a bit irritated I think. Couldn't be really sure since most people there seemed irritated. I'll blame the Monday.) guided me right. Turned out I had to take a transit bus to a whole other airport that took care of domestic flights. There I waited another four and a half hour before finally leaving for Murmansk (ÐÑÑÐ¼Ð°Ð½Ñ&#1082<img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/w/wink.gif" width="15" height="15" alt=";)" title=";) (Wink)" />. But not before having a quite one-sided conversation with an old lady, not understanding that my shoes needs to be x-rayed as well, receiving patronising (sometimes even pitiful) gazes from non-englishspeaking security personnel and being pushed and showed in every way imaginable.<br />   The trip itself took just below two hours and I have to admit that I was getting more and more excited. Soon I would actually see and hold the one I've missed for so long. The food on the plane was excellent. Even though I was travelling in economy class I got a cold meal that almost was more than I could handle. On the flight with SAS I got nothing at all... Here's to Rossiya airlines! <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/a/ahoy.gif" width="31" height="19" alt=":ahoy:" title="Ahooooy Matey!" /><br />   The first time I got really scared during this trip was when I arrived at the airport, checked out and got out into the exit hall only to find out that she wasn't there. I had some five minutes of agony trying to figure out if there could somehow have been a mistake in when I would arrive, mixed with thoughts of all the horrid things that could have hindered her coming. Then I turned around and there she was. <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/s/smile.gif" width="15" height="15" alt=":)" title=":) (Smile)" /> To say that I was relieved and happy is a grave understatement. <br />   The trip back also went fine, but in reverse order. I also felt a lot more confident then as well. <img src="http://e.deviantart.com/emoticons/r/razz.gif" width="15" height="15" alt="=P" title="=P (Razz)" /><br />   Now to the question on what I did there. Besides such romantic (I shit you not) things as playing through Myst IV together, we also had time to go out and have some "real" dates together. The restaurant and cinema type mainly. We had sushi, which was quite expensive considering what we actually got. You could get more here for half the money. Still it was nice to come out and see the surroundings. The grill/pub we went to another day was more of a success. Really tasty food, and almost more than one could eat.<br />   One thing that actually was surprisingly cheap was transportation. For less than $8 I could ride the trolleys trafficking the whole city for ten days!<br />   Cinema was also nice. We watched a movie simply called <i>The best movie ever</i>. A comedy by some famous Russian comedians. While I can't say that it was the best movie I've ever seen, it still was funny. Most things I didn't have to know the language to understand, and the rest Taya translated there or explained to me afterwards. I would recommend it to anyone who likes movies like: <i>American Pie</i> and <i>Dumb and Dumber</i>.<br />   First person to greet me when I got home to them was her mother, which according to Taya's testamony is: "A very easygoing person". And I can only agree with her. We got along fine and she didn't mind the fact that we couldn't really talk. Her sister was quite shy and didn't say much either even though she talks both both English and Norvegian. She left the morning after and did not return before I left. <br />   Her father came home from the ship he works on (as a diver) just some days before I left but he immediately warmed up to me, and I have to admit that I liked him from the start. The day I was leaving he got up really early in the morning and followed me to the airport just to see me off. Ta... ]]></description>
